Campaign Strategy Intern information

What is a campaign strategy intern?

Campaign Strategy Interns are entry-level professionals who support the planning, execution, and analysis of campaigns, often in marketing, political, or advocacy organizations. Their responsibilities typically include conducting research, analyzing data, assisting with the development of campaign materials, and coordinating with various teams to ensure campaigns run smoothly. This role provides hands-on experience in strategic thinking and project management, making it ideal for students or recent graduates interested in careers related to marketing, communications, or public relations.

What types of projects and responsibilities can a campaign strategy intern expect during their internship?

As a Campaign Strategy Intern, you can expect to assist in the planning, execution, and analysis of marketing or advocacy campaigns. Typical responsibilities include conducting market or audience research, supporting the development of campaign messaging, coordinating with creative and digital teams, and preparing performance reports. You'll likely collaborate closely with strategists, copywriters, and data analysts, gaining exposure to various campaign stages. This hands-on experience provides valuable insight into industry best practices and can open doors to full-time roles in marketing or communications upon completion.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a campaign strategy int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Campaign Strategy Intern, you need a solid understanding of marketing principles, strong analytical skills, and preferably a background in communications, marketing, or a related field. Familiarity with digital marketing tools, social media platforms, and data analytics software such as Google Analytics or HubSpot is often expected. Creativity, attention to detail, and strong teamwork and communication skills help interns contribute effectively to campaign planning and execution. These abilities ensure that interns can support impactful campaigns, interpret data-driven insights, and collaborate efficiently with cross-functional teams.

What is the difference between Campaign Strategy Intern vs Marketing Intern?

AspectCampaign Strategy InternMarketing Intern
ResponsibilitiesDeveloping campaign plans, analyzing campaign performance, supporting strategic initiativesAssisting with marketing campaigns, content creation, market research
Required SkillsAnalytical skills, understanding of marketing strategies, communication skillsCreativity, communication skills, basic marketing knowledge
Work EnvironmentStrategic planning teams, campaign development projectsMarketing departments, content creation teams
Common UsageUsed in advertising agencies, corporate marketing teamsUsed across various industries for general marketing roles

The main difference between a Campaign Strategy Intern and a Marketing Intern lies in their focus. Campaign Strategy Interns concentrate on developing and analyzing specific marketing campaigns and strategic planning, while Marketing Interns typically support broader marketing activities such as content creation and market research. Both roles require strong communication skills, but Campaign Strategy Interns often need more analytical and strategic thinking skills.

About Anthropocene Alliance:


Anthropocene Alliance (A2) is the nation's largest coalition of frontline communities fighting for climate and environmental justice. We work with over 400 member communities across the U.S. to support grassroots leaders addressing pollution, climate change, and systemic environmental inequities.


Position Overview:

We are seeking a motivated, passionate Communications Intern to support our communications team. Interns will gain hands-on experience in grassroots communications, storytelling, digital outreach, and media relations while helping amplify frontline leaders' voices and campaigns.
